About the University of Maine at Fort Kent

The University of Maine at Fort Kent (UMFK), established in 1878, is a public university located in Fort Kent, Maine. It is part of the University of Maine System and is known for its commitment to providing high-quality education in a rural setting. UMFK offers a range of undergraduate programs with a focus on healthcare, education, and environmental sciences.

Academic Excellence and Programs

UMFK prides itself on its small class sizes and personalized attention to students. The university offers over 20 undergraduate degree programs, with notable strengths in Nursing, Teacher Education, and Environmental Studies. The Nursing program is particularly renowned, with a high pass rate on the NCLEX-RN licensure exam, preparing students for successful careers in healthcare.

Research and Innovation

While primarily an undergraduate institution, UMFK engages in research that benefits the local community and beyond. The university's Acadian Archives and Acadian Center are dedicated to preserving and promoting the Acadian culture and heritage. Additionally, UMFK's Environmental Studies program conducts research on sustainable practices and environmental conservation, contributing to the global effort to address climate change.

Community Engagement and Impact

UMFK is deeply committed to its community. The university's Community Service Learning program integrates service into the curriculum, allowing students to apply their knowledge in real-world settings. This initiative not only enhances student learning but also strengthens the bond between the university and the local community. UMFK also hosts various cultural events and outreach programs that enrich the cultural fabric of Fort Kent.

Facilities and Campus Life

UMFK's campus is nestled in the scenic St. John Valley, offering a beautiful and inspiring environment for learning and living. The university provides modern facilities, including state-of-the-art laboratories, classrooms, and residence halls. The campus also features recreational facilities and is a hub for outdoor activities such as hiking, skiing, and snowmobiling.

UMFK Employee Benefits Beyond Salary

Employee Benefits at the University of Maine at Fort Kent

The University of Maine at Fort Kent (UMFK) offers a comprehensive range of benefits designed to support the well-being and professional development of its employees.

  • Health and Wellness: UMFK provides health insurance, dental insurance, and vision insurance to ensure that employees and their families have access to quality healthcare.
  • Retirement Plans: Employees can participate in retirement plans such as the Maine Public Employees Retirement System (MainePERS), which offers a secure and stable retirement income.
  • Professional Development: UMFK is committed to the career growth of its staff. The university offers training programs, workshops, and tuition waivers for employees pursuing further education.
  • Work-Life Balance: UMFK supports a healthy work-life balance with flexible work schedules, paid time off, and family leave policies.
  • Employee Assistance Program: The university provides an Employee Assistance Program (EAP) that offers confidential counseling and support services to help employees manage personal and professional challenges.
  • Recreational Facilities: Employees have access to recreational facilities on campus, including gyms, sports fields, and fitness classes, promoting a healthy lifestyle.
  • Community Involvement: UMFK encourages staff to participate in community service and volunteer opportunities, fostering a sense of community engagement and giving back.

These benefits reflect UMFK's dedication to creating a supportive and rewarding work environment for its employees.
